Sound Bath Etiquette, Notes & Contraindications

Sound Bath Session Etiquette:

• Arrive at the Kauffman Center at least 15 minutes before your session to allow plenty of time to select your spot and settle in.
• Prior to the sound bath experience, turn off or silence cell phones and other devices that could make noise.
• Falling asleep during a sound bath is common. If you fall asleep and happen to remain asleep into the conclusion of the session, the practitioner may gently touch your feet, shoulders/back to wake you.

Important Notes & Contraindications:

• It is highly recommended to be well-hydrated (with water) before and after sound bath sessions.
• Drinking alcoholic beverages is not advised before or after a sound bath.
• Sound healing/sound baths are not recommended during the first trimester of pregnancy.
• Sound healing/sound baths are not recommended for those with sound-induced epilepsy.
• Sound healing/sound baths are not recommended for those who have a history of severe depression, psychosis and other serious mental health challenges.
• Individual experiences may vary.
